Pre-war and historic-district housing
Moving & Heavy Lifting on older and historic homes in Newton
This is the archetype where measuring first is not optional. Pre-standard doorways, stairwells that turn at a landing with no room to pivot, low basement headroom and narrow attic access all mean a substantial share of furniture cannot travel the route it needs to. Original stair treads, plaster walls and painted trim also damage easily and expensively — a gouged plaster corner is a real repair, not a touch-up. We protect the path more heavily in these houses than anywhere else, and we will tell you before lifting when a piece needs partial disassembly to make a turn.
Acreage, outbuildings and rural property
The other half of Newton: rural and acreage property
Rural moves are mostly about the approach rather than the house. Long gravel drives that a loaded truck cannot climb after rain, gates that need removing, and outbuildings with no proper door threshold at all. The items are also bigger: gun safes, shop equipment, workbenches, freezers, farm and tractor implements. Safes in particular need honest assessment — beyond a certain weight it is rigging work and needs equipment and insurance we do not carry, and we would rather say that than find out on a ramp.

Send these
Three photos and we can usually answer without driving out
Regular service area in central Catawba County.
- The destination space, so we know where it is going
- The item, with something for scale
- Every doorway on the route, and the narrowest point
A single item within a house is usually under an hour. Whole-room rearrangement or a storage unit load runs a half day. Truck loading depends on volume.
